How much does it cost to rent a home in Hilton Head Island?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hilton Head Island 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,344 | $1,800 | $3,500 |
| Hilton Head Island 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,938 | $2,000 | $4,800 |
| Hilton Head Island 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,925 | $3,900 | $6,500 |
| Hilton Head Island 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,850 | $2,850 | $2,850 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Hilton Head Island
What type of rentals are currently available in Hilton Head Island?
There are currently 62 Apartments for Rent in Hilton Head Island, SC with pricing that ranges from $883 to $21,251. There are also 78 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Hilton Head Island ranging from $1,300 to $6,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Hilton Head Island?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Hilton Head Island ranges from $1,300 to $6,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,962.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Hilton Head Island?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Hilton Head Island range from $1,574 to $12,795,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,000 to $4,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,650.
